The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Dunlop, born in 1843 in Stewarton, Ayrshire, consisted of 7 members. James was the head of the household, married to Ann Dunlop, born in 1846 in Mearns, Renfrewshire, Scotland. They had 5 children; Elizabeth (born 1865 in Stewarton, Ayrshire, Scotland), Jane (born 1867 in Stewarton, Ayrshire, Scotland), James (born 1870 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land), Annie (born 1873 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land) and William (born 1878 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land).
